1990's - 2010's
In the mid-1990’s, federal ownership rules for media outlet ownership changed again, removing most limits on broadcast station ownership. KFBK became part of Clear Channel communications, which in September 2014 was renamed to the station’s current owner, iHeartMedia.





In June of 2012, KFBK moved buildings from Ethan way, to the current home on River Park Drive. At the end of 2013, after successfully testing FM simulcasting of its 50,000-watt signal at 1530AM, KFBK moved its FM broadcast frequency to the current 93.1FM.
